An electrical wiring diagram definition centers on a visual representation that maps out the physical or logical connections within an electrical system. Unlike a simple sketch, this diagram serves as a detailed blueprint, using standardized symbols to depict components such as outlets, switches, circuit breakers, and the wiring that connects them. Its primary purpose is to illustrate how electricity flows from a source, through various controls, and finally to a load, providing a clear roadmap for installation, troubleshooting, and repair.
Core Components of Electrical Schematics
Understanding the electrical wiring diagram definition requires familiarity with its foundational elements. These diagrams utilize a universal language of symbols that transcends regional differences in wiring color codes or component brands. Each symbol represents a specific device, such as a lamp, a resistor, or a transformer, ensuring that the diagram remains a precise tool for communication. The lines connecting these symbols represent the actual conductors, or wires, that carry electrical current throughout the circuit.
Symbols and Line Styles
The specific shapes and marks used in these diagrams are critical for accurate interpretation. A solid line typically indicates a live connection, while a dotted or dashed line might represent a control circuit or a hidden connection in a schematic. Furthermore, the diagrams often include annotations, such as wire gauges, voltage ratings, and component identifiers, which provide essential technical data. This standardized symbology ensures that an electrician in New York can interpret a diagram drawn by an engineer in Germany with minimal ambiguity.

Practical Applications in Installation and Repair
While the theoretical definition is important, the true value of an electrical wiring diagram is realized in practical scenarios. During the installation of a new appliance or the construction of a building, these diagrams guide electricians in routing cables through conduits and connecting terminals correctly. They eliminate guesswork, ensuring that the physical wiring matches the intended design. This adherence to the plan is vital for both safety and functionality, preventing dangerous shorts or miswires that could lead to system failure.
Troubleshooting with Precision
When a circuit fails, the electrical wiring diagram definition becomes a diagnostic tool. Technicians use these maps to trace the path of electricity, identifying where the flow has been interrupted. Whether a fuse has blown, a switch has failed, or a wire has been severed behind a wall, the diagram allows the professional to isolate the problem quickly. By comparing the expected path on the diagram with the actual voltage readings taken at various points, the root cause of the issue can be identified efficiently.
Distinguishing Between Diagram Types
It is essential to note that the term "electrical wiring diagram" can refer to different levels of detail. Pictorial diagrams show the physical appearance of components, making them easier to visualize for beginners. In contrast, schematic diagrams focus on the logical function of the circuit, abstracting away the physical layout. A robust definition encompasses both the physical wiring routes and the logical flow of current, ensuring that the document serves as a comprehensive guide regardless of the viewer's specific need.

Safety and Regulatory Compliance
Beyond utility, a properly maintained electrical wiring diagram is a cornerstone of safety and legal compliance. Building codes and electrical regulations often mandate that such documentation exists for commercial and residential installations. In the event of an inspection or an insurance claim, these diagrams prove that the work was performed to standard. They provide evidence that the grounding, circuit protection, and load calculations were considered during the initial build, mitigating risks associated with electrical fires or shock hazards.
The Evolution of Electrical Documentation
The definition of an electrical wiring diagram has evolved significantly with technology. While hand-drawn blueprints were once the norm, modern systems utilize sophisticated Computer-Aided Design (CAD) software. These digital files allow for greater precision, easier sharing, and the integration of real-time data. Today's diagrams can be linked to a database of components, updating automatically when a change is made. This digital shift preserves the core purpose of the diagram—providing a clear, accurate representation—while enhancing accessibility and efficiency for modern electrical professionals.
